Metadata
- Source
- FLUID-5516
- Type
- Bug
- Priority
- Critical
- Status
- Closed
- Resolution
- Fixed
- Assignee
- Jonathan Hung
- Reporter
- Jonathan Hung
- Created
2014-09-24T15:13:31.447-0400 - Updated
2014-11-19T11:23:04.155-0500 - Versions
- N/A
- Fixed Versions
- N/A
- Component
-
- Website
Description
The fluidproject build site design has changed. Currently it looks too much like a project / brochure site http://build.fluidproject.org/ with coloured project tiles at the top with links below. The updated design is more conventional as to not cause any confusion between the build site and the parent fluidproject.org site.
The work is to be done using plain old HTML + CSS (no need for docpad or anything else).
Relevant links:
- The new design can be found on page 6 of this PDF:
http://wiki.fluidproject.org/download/attachments/327842/FluidProject-WebsiteMockup.pdf?version=1&modificationDate=1401984558871&api=v2
- The build site can be found in this github repository:
https://github.com/fluid-project/build.fluidproject.org
- The live build site is
http://build.fluidproject.org/
Comments
-
Anastasia Cheetham commented
2014-10-30T14:08:58.038-0400 Justin and I discussed the issue of the page being too long (http://lists.idrc.ocad.ca/pipermail/fluid-work/2014-October/009582.html). The plan is:
1) Remove links to “examples” and keep only “demos”
The “examples” are more instructional in purpose, and will hopefully eventually be moved into the documentation itself. Also, we’re not entirely sure if they’re currently using all of our recommended best practices, so we’re not sure if we want to point people to them. Our thoughts are
a) Review the examples to decide if we’re proud of them (if not, update them).
b) Decide whether or not to
i) move the examples to the documentation, or
ii) create a second page on the build site for the examples.2a) Limit automated test links to “all-tests” files.
2b) Add to the Infusion repository “all-tests” files for
i) Renderer tests
ii) Framework tests (all of them)
iii) Component tests (all of them)
and add these links to the build site. (FLUID-5544)3) Restructure the layout of the build site as follows: Left column for demos, right column for tests (automated at top, manual at bottom).
-
Anastasia Cheetham commented
2014-11-07T10:34:20.272-0500 Merged at 89a166b8e75afb2d84be021c1c9d125038a0b04a